Addverb, a world contributor in industrial robotics and warehouse automation, has introduced its partnership with Infineon Applied sciences AG, a world contributor in energy methods and IoT. This partnership incorporates Bluetooth Low Power (BLE)-based communication methods into Addverb’s robotic fleet to deal with essential security considerations. It demonstrates Addverb’s dedication to enhancing security protocols and creating scalable robotics capabilities, fostering an adaptable ecosystem that meets world requirements. 

Addverb has carried out the upgraded resolution throughout Zippy 10 robots in lively warehouse environments. These options allow security protocols past normal Wi-Fi infrastructure, with a BLE-powered emergency cease system that deactivates robots in delicate conditions inside seconds to forestall pitfalls. The deployment additionally features a distant energy cut-off function, enabling centralised energy administration for giant robotic fleets with out handbook intervention.
